A 5-year-old boy was found dead hours after he disappeared from his Florida home, police said.
Orange County Sheriff’s Office announced the death of Aaron Penn with a “heavy heart”. Aaron was described by the sheriff’s office as a “non-verbal child with autism.”
“We have to announce that Aaron Peña was found dead in a body of water near his home,” the sheriff’s office said in a Facebook post Thursday, Nov. 24. “We mourn his loss and our prayers are with his family.”
Aaron is missing around 12:45 pm on Wednesday after his mother noticed the back door was open, according to WESH.
“He’s also attracted to bodies of water, so I immediately went to the pool and the pond,” Melissa Stanton told WESH of her son.
His disappearance prompted the sheriff’s office to issue a missing child report. Aaron was wearing a brown long sleeve shirt and dinosaur pajama pants when he went missing from his home in Orlando, the sheriff’s office said.
Aaron, the youngest of Stanton’s three children, was found in the pond around 1 a.m. on Thursdayreports WKMG.
The sheriff did not release a cause of death.
